Weekend Box Office Results
THIS WEEK / TOTAL SO FAR
1.) Apocalypto $14,166,000 / $14,166,000
2.) The Holiday $13,500,000 / $13,500,000
3.) Happy Feet $12,710,000 / $137,738,000
4.) Casino Royale $8,800,000 / $128,894,000
5.) Blood Diamond $8,515,000 / $8,515,000
6.) Unaccompanied Minors $6,205,000 / $6,205,000
7.) Deja Vu $6,070,000 / $53,046,000
8.) The Nativity Story $5,575,000 / $15,769,000
9.) Deck the Halls $3,925,000 / $30,077,000
10.) The Santa Clause 3 $3,311,000 / $77,240,000
This weekend Mel Gibson defied convention and grabbed the #1 spot with his bizarre movie “Apocalypto”. The movie didn’t do big numbers but was a surprise debut.
